Vision

It is not just an experience but a state of being to be a mother. It’s unlike anything else ever felt – and nothing is more divine than the relationship between a mother and a child. While many children are blessed to experience this unique bonding, many are deprived of their most basic right – the right to be loved and raised in a secure environment! If children in distress are not provided with equal access to life’s opportunities that each deserves to have, their inclusion into the mainstream society will be difficult.

This is where Reverend Didi Maa Sadhvi Ritambhara’s inspiration, Vatsalya Gram plays a pivotal role. The vision of Vatsalya Gram is to empower every underprivileged child and woman to experience this sacred relationship of love and respect, and to help them realise their fullest potential thereby becoming contributing members of the society. The vision is to provide with a loving home for destitute children and women, and lonely grandmothers so that they may live like families and form emotional bonds as parents and siblings, thus securing India’s future through happy, confident and self-reliant children.

India’s population is increasing at an unprecedented rate, and with that, the population of orphaned children in India also grows everyday. These children, who are often abandoned to a life of destitution and grief, do not have a lot of places to go to, and in the end lose their childhood fending for themselves and trying to keep alive on the streets.

The overstuffed orphanages in India are not the right kind of environment to bring up a happy and healthy child and it was this that gave Pujya Didi Maa Sadhvi Rithambhra the idea to create a place where children can have a normal and happy life.

Sadhvi Rithambhara envisions a country where each child has a happy childhood and is given all the resources which are necessary for their growth and development – not only physically but also emotionally and intellectually. Vatsalya Gram is a product of the vision of Didi Maa and offers a home to the orphaned and the destitute.

In the coming years, the concept of Vatsalya Gram, as seen in Vrindavan, will be replicated in several places in India so that more and more children can have a brighter future.
